What I have is the following:

In Themes, I have “Show top toolbar” and “Standard” checked. That can of course be alternated with “Show ribbon” if you like that, I don’t, so I have it off (even in Windows). But for a Windows theme, by default I guess Show Ribbon should be checked, as it resembles Windows default. In addition I have “Command options dialog” checked, and “Main” in the sidebar palette. “Include osnaps in sidebar” is UNCHECKED,

In Tool Pallet, I have everything as default. What WOULD be nice here is the option for floating tool pallets to fly out with “Left click and hold” WITHOUT having to hold the Alt key. That would really work more like Windows.

Lastly, I have the left sidebar narrowed down to 2 icons, and the right sidebar with Properties showing on top and layers on the bottom.
